首页> 外国专利> METHOD AND SYSTEM FOR INCREASING SAFETY IN A BOARDING AREA AND FOR OPTIMISING USAGE OF THE CAPACITY IN TRANSPORT MEANS

摘要

In terms of the method the boarding area (A, B, C) of a transport means (9) isdividedinto at least two gates (1, 2, 3), the maximum person capacity of whichrespectivelycorresponds to the maximum capacity of the largest transport means (9), whichis accessiblevia the boarding area (A, B, C), wherein entrance into the gates (1, 2, 3) iseffected via atleast one separating device (4) connected with the control system (5) for thepurpose of datacommunication and wherein entrance into a gate (1, 2, 3) is not possible, oncethe numberof persons in the gate (1, 2, 3) specified by the control system (5) for thecurrent boardingoperation is reached, or while the persons inside a gate (1, 2, 3) board atransport means,wherein the number of persons in a gate (1, 2, 3) specified for the currentboardingoperation is determined by the control system (5) in dependence of thetransport demand insubsequent intermediate stations ahead of an end station, providedintermediate stationsexist, and of the free capacity of the arriving transport means (9), whereinfor the currentboarding operation the persons inside a gate (1, 2, 3) are assigned to anarriving transportmeans (9), and wherein the current number of persons inside a gate (1, 2, 3)is detected viaat least one separating device (4) and forwarded to the control system (5),and whereinwhen the number of persons inside the gate (1, 2, 3) specified for the currentboardingoperation has been reached or when a specified timer which corresponds to aspecified timewindow has expired and a transport means (9) arrives to which the personscurrently in thegate (1, 2, 3) are assigned, the persons which are inside the gate (1, 2, 3)are requested toboard and a counter for the number of persons in the gate (1, 2, 3) is set tozero.
